#a54807 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a54807 is composed of 64.7% red, 28.2%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.4% magenta, 95.8%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 24.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.9% and a lightness of 33.7%. #a54807 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ff900e with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#a54807

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0601 is the darkest color, while #fffc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#a54807

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5550 is the less saturated color, while #ac4700 is the most saturated one.
